As we continue through the third week of Lent, Christ reminds us of the greatest commandment: to love God with all our heart, soul, and mind. True devotion is not partial. It is wholehearted.
Today we pray for undivided love.
Bible Verse of the Day
” You shall love the Lord, your God, with all your heart, with all your soul, and with all your mind.” – Matthew 22:37
A Prayer for Wholehearted Love
Lord God,
You call me to love You with all my heart, all my soul, and all my mind. Yet I confess that my love is often divided. I give You part of my attention, part of my devotion, part of my trust.
Forgive me for loving You half-heartedly. Forgive me for allowing other priorities to overshadow my relationship with You.
Teach me to love You completely. Let my thoughts reflect Your truth. Let my desires align with Your will. Let my actions glorify Your name.
Remove anything that competes with You in my heart. Purify my attachments. Help me to place You first in every area of my life.
During this Lenten journey, deepen my love. Let it be sincere, faithful, and joyful. May my devotion grow stronger each day.
Through Christ our Lord.
Amen.
